Class action lawsuits
A mesothelioma suit involves filing an action for compensation against the businesses which exposed asbestos-related victims to the cancer. The lawsuit seeks damages for the losses suffered by the victim, including medical expenses, lost wages and pain and suffering. The lawsuit also covers other emotional or financial losses that could be a result of the patient's illness.
The lawsuit is filed by the victim or their family member. The process begins with a no-cost consultation with an attorney. This lawyer will examine the victim's history of exposure and determine if they are eligible to receive compensation. They will also help with filing the claim with the appropriate place of jurisdiction. After the claims process has started, the lawyers will begin to collect evidence and manage any responses from defendants.
Defendants try to settle cases of mesothelioma prior to going to the courtroom. They know that victims of mesothelioma have to pay huge expenses and may not be able to afford a lengthy trial. This is why it's important to find a seasoned attorney who can negotiate with defendants to get the most favorable settlement.
If you make a mesothelioma claim, your lawyer will begin collecting evidence for the case. They will also examine your medical records and results of mesothelioma tests. Then, they will prepare a demand letter which will be sent to the defendants. They will also explain your rights and the time limit for filing a claim.
Class action lawsuits for mesothelioma are no anymore common. However, many families still have the option of suing asbestos companies. These lawsuits include mesothelioma claims that are similar, and allow the courts a more efficient hearing than individual cases. This type of lawsuit also helps prevent overcrowding of the courts which can delay the justice process for mesothelioma patients.
A wrongful death lawsuit may be filed if a loved one is diagnosed with mesothelioma. This is in addition to an asbestos lawsuit. This lawsuit seeks to establish that the family of the victim was financially dependent on the deceased and that the cause of death was negligent asbestos exposure.
A successful lawsuit could lead to an agreement. The amount of the settlement will be contingent on the severity of the injuries suffered by the victim and their responsibility. If medical expenses are due, they will be paid in full by the settlement.
Settlements
If you or someone close to you has been diagnosed with mesothelioma it is crucial to file a lawsuit within your state's statute of limitations. The deadline for filing a lawsuit varies from state to state, so it is best to seek legal advice as soon as possible. An experienced lawyer can help you determine the best timeframe for your case and make sure that it is filed before this deadline expires.
The mesothelioma compensation process can be complicated and challenging, but an experienced mesothelioma lawyer can help you through the process. These attorneys have experience handling these cases and can negotiate with the defendants to get a fair settlement for you. They can also help you learn the terms of the settlement so that you can make an informed decision about whether to accept it or not.
In general, mesothelioma lawsuits are settled outside of court because many victims need immediate financial assistance to pay for medical treatment. Settlement amounts vary depending on the victim however, they are usually between six and seven figures. Some mesothelioma patients have received higher jury awards.
The most popular reason for a mesothelioma lawsuit is to hold asbestos companies accountable for their actions. These companies knew about the dangers of asbestos, but failed to warn their employees and the general public. Asbestos victims require financial compensation to pay their medical bills, funeral expenses, and other costs.
A mesothelioma lawsuit can also be used to seek compensation for the loss of wages. Since mesothelioma patients must focus on their treatment, they're unable to work, which means losing income. Patients with mesothelioma may also need to travel long distances for treatment, which could result in a significant medical expense.
When negotiating a settlement agreement for mesothelioma victims, they should also consider their financial needs. Some victims may have liens imposed against them. This means they'll need to pay money first before they can receive any settlement. Certain companies who have declared bankruptcy might not pay any settlements.
A mesothelioma lawyer will explain the factors that affect the amount of settlement. The amount of settlement can be influenced by the mesothelioma patient's aging or exposure history, or other unique circumstances.
Trials
A mesothelioma suit can help victims and their families get compensation for damages. These damages could include funeral expenses, and income loss. A successful lawsuit can also provide financial security in the future.
The primary cause of mesothelioma is exposure to asbestos. In the industrial era businesses put profits ahead of workers' safety and exposed millions to the harmful substance. As a result, many patients and their loved ones suffer from mesothelioma and asbestos-related diseases. Mesothelioma lawyers have experience in representing asbestos-related patients against negligent asbestos-related companies.
There are several types of mesothelioma lawsuits. They include personal injury and wrongful death suits. The estates of victims of mesothelioma or asbestos-related illnesses may file wrongful death lawsuits. Settlements for asbestos lawsuits can be substantial, and can pay victims for the losses they suffered.
Asbestos-related victims can choose to start a lawsuit on their own or join a class action lawsuit. However, class action lawsuits have been typically unsuccessful and offer a lesser amount of compensation than those given in individual cases. In addition it is important to remember that asbestos statutes of limitations differ according to the state.
A mesothelioma lawyer will help victims to understand their legal options and decide the best way to proceed. Most mesothelioma lawsuits are settled prior to trial. This is because trials can be expensive and can be difficult for victims to endure. In most cases victims and their families are able to negotiate a favorable settlement with the company responsible for their asbestos exposure.
In certain cases, disputes about the amount to which an individual plaintiff is entitled to could complicate mesothelioma lawsuits. This is especially the case when there are multiple companies involved in the case. In this situation, it is important for victims and their lawyers to collaborate to ensure that they get the compensation they are entitled to.
Although it is unsettling that mesothelioma victims and their families are faced with the rigors of medical treatment, they should not have to bear the burden of the financial impact. An attorney for mesothelioma can assist victims and their families receive the compensation they deserve.
Attorney fees
A mesothelioma case could help victims receive compensation to cover medical expenses, income loss, as well as pain and discomfort. The compensation received by victims will not compensate for the disease. Nevertheless the compensation they receive can provide financial support for their families.
The law firm you choose should have extensive experience with mesothelioma cases as well as a demonstrated track of success. The law firm should provide an initial consultation for free to determine whether you or your loved one have an appropriate claim. The lawyers will assist you to complete the required documents and ensure that deadlines are adhered to. They will also be knowledgeable about how different factors, like awards caps and statutes of limitation, impact the asbestos settlement amount.
Mesothelioma lawyers can assist victims to file a claim for workers compensation, which could help pay for treatment and provide income while they are receiving treatment. They can also assist with filing a personal injury lawsuit against the companies who are responsible for their exposure asbestos.
Many asbestos-related companies have set up trust funds to compensate mesothelioma patients. These trusts can be used to pay for treatment as well as lost wages and funeral expenses. A skilled lawyer can identify the responsible asbestos companies and ensure that victims receive the maximum payout possible from these trust funds.
As with other personal injury lawsuits, mesothelioma suits are more complex and require an experienced attorney to navigate the process. A defendant may employ an attorney to sabotage your claim but a mesothelioma lawyer can thwart these attempts and keep your case moving forward.
